At the heart of this setup is the American Defense Manufacturing UIC 13.9, a lightweight and durable AR platform designed for versatility. Featuring a 13.9-inch barrel, this rifle strikes a perfect balance between maneuverability and accuracy. Its free-floating M-LOK handguard offers ample space for attachments while maintaining a streamlined profile, ideal for tactical applications.

Enhancing Suppression: JK Armament JK 155 GOAT 5.56mm HF

The JK Armament JK 155 GOAT suppressor brings exceptional noise reduction and recoil management to the table. Designed for the 5.56mm platform, this modular suppressor allows shooters to customize its length and configuration to suit their needs. Its lightweight construction ensures minimal impact on handling, making it a practical addition for precision and stealth operations.

Optical Superiority: Trijicon ACOG TA50

For optics, the Trijicon ACOG TA50 is a clear choice. Renowned for its ruggedness and reliability, this compact scope provides crystal-clear magnification and an illuminated reticle powered by fiber optics and tritium. With its fixed 3x magnification, the ACOG TA50 is perfectly suited for mid-range engagements, offering rapid target acquisition and pinpoint accuracy in various lighting conditions.
